What is a ton of fill-dirt worth and how much space does it take?
A ton is 2,000 lbs, but the volume that represents varies with moisture and material type. In New England subsoils, 1 cubic yard often weighs around 1.1 to 1.4 tons, so one ton is roughly 0.7 to 0.9 cubic yards; confirm exact yards-per-ton with your supplier before ordering.
What are common uses for fill-dirt around Portland homes and jobsites?
Fill-dirt is used for raising low spots, leveling yards, backfilling trenches, building simple landscape berms, and creating non-structural grade to prepare for foundations or driveways. In coastal Portland, it is also used to fix drainage slopes and regrade yards to reduce standing water.
Can you just put fill-dirt over existing dirt in your yard?
For small adjustments you can add fill-dirt over existing soil, but success depends on proper placement and compaction. For planting, cap fill-dirt with at least 4-6 inches of topsoil; for structural use or large fills, compact in lifts and consult a contractor or engineer to avoid settling and erosion.
Will fill-dirt harden like concrete or make a firm driveway surface?
No. Fill-dirt compacts but does not harden like concrete and will rut or wash away if used as the wearing surface. For driveways, use fill-dirt only as a subgrade; install a compacted crushed stone base and proper drainage for a durable surface.
Which is cheaper: crushed stone or fill-dirt in Portland?
Fill-dirt is usually cheaper because it is unprocessed subsoil, while crushed stone requires quarrying and crushing. That said, crushed stone has structural benefits that may be required for driveways, pads, and drainage, so compare cost against project needs.
How much area does a truckload of fill-dirt cover in Portland?
Coverage depends on truck size and desired depth. A typical tri-axle dump truck carries about 10 to 14 cubic yards; at 6 inches depth, one 12-yard load covers about 432 sq ft, and at 1 inch depth it covers roughly 3,888 sq ft. Will 1 ton of fill-dirt fit in a pickup truck?
A standard half-ton pickup truck bed can hold roughly 0.5 to 1 cubic yard depending on load limits and bed dimensions, so one ton may fit physically but could exceed vehicle weight limits. Does adding fill-dirt increase property value in Portland?
Properly placed fill-dirt can improve usability, fix drainage issues, and reduce flood risk, which can make a property more attractive to buyers. However, fill alone rarely adds major value unless it enables permitted improvements like a properly graded yard, driveway, or foundation repairs.
Do I need compaction testing or permits for large fill projects in Portland?
For small landscaping fills you usually do not need testing, but structural fills, building pads, or major regrading may require compaction testing and permits from Portland city departments. Check local building and planning rules and consult an engineer for foundation or large-scale work before placing significant volumes of fill-dirt.
